Your bill must be typed and contain the following: A title that describes the subject of the bill. Declaration of your name, state represented and membership in standing committee. Section One: Define important terms. Section Two: Explain the bill's purpose. Section Three: Describe the ...

Section 3 is the actual lawmaking part of the bill. This is where you say what the bill is going to do. This may take multiple sections. A bill should be written so that each individual thing the bill is doing will be its own section. You may also need a section on how the bill will be funded. The United States Congress is the legislature of the federal government of the United States. It is bicameral, composed of a lower body, the House of Representatives, and an upper body, the Senate. It meets in the U.S. Capitol in Washington, D.C. Senators and representatives are chosen through direct election, though vacancies in the Senate may ...

Mock Congress Procedure When all House Bills are passed, they will be sent to the Senate. When Senate Bills are passed, they will be sent to the House of Representatives. In order for a bill to become a law, both the House of Representatives and the Senate must approve it. Lastly, the president of the United States must sign the bill to law.

Bernstein Model Congress Welcome Info PMC 2023 conference Members Advisors Info PMC 2023 conference Members AdvisorsHow Bills Start. It all starts with an idea to impact change. Ideas can originate from legislators, outside legislative entities (e.g. departments, agencies, etc.), or members of the community. All have the power to submit proposed legislation to influence change.
